Episode Summary

Seating Order: Wayne, Kathy, Colin, and Ryan.

Hollywood Director: Colin directs the following scene: Hunky plumber Ryan is finishing up installing a new shower when frisky housewife Kathy insists on testing it. Kathy's outraged mother, Wayne, makes a dramatic entrance.''Styles: like fast-talking gangsters from a 40's film noir, like they have giant butts, and like a violent, slow-motion shoot-out.''Three-Headed Broadway Star: Wayne, Ryan and Colin sing 'I Can't Stop Thinking About Your Pants' to audience member Gillian.''Scenes From A Hat: What the Queen of England is really saying to the people in the greeting line; what Lassie was really trying to tell everyone; people you wouldn't want to go on an intergalactic flight with; if adults settled disputes the way kids do; and if songs were written about life's most embarassing moments.''Helping Hands: Kathy has gone to visit her Austrian penpal(Ryan with Colin's hands) and he wants to impress her by taking her out on a romantic Alpine picnic.''Props: Wayne and Colin vs. Ryan and Drew.

Winner: Kathy''Credit Reading: Wayne and Kathy as a couple looking at puppies in a pet shop window and Ryan and Colin act as puppies trying to get them to take them home.moreless

      • Pay attention during Props when Ryan asks Drew, as a doctor, to remove fat from his behind. He says celluloid again instead of cellulite. Ryan has swapped the terms around before in a previously aired episode. This might have been a reference to that or Ryan just made the same mistake again. Edit
